One Piece surprisingly realistic: Here's Netflix discharge time for each area

Netflix will deliver the surprisingly realistic transformation of the Japanese manga series One Piece on August 31st.

Enthusiasts of the Japanese manga series One Piece have been enthusiastically trusting that the surprisingly realistic variation will hit Netflix.

The stand by is practically finished, as Eiichiro Oda's creation will be delivered on the streaming stage on Thursday, August 31st.


The series follows the undertakings of Monkey D. Luffy (IƱaki Godoy), a youthful privateer who fantasies about tracking down the incredible fortune of Gold Rogers. Along his excursion, he meets different privateers who either help him or block him in his mission.


The Straw Team Cap's adventure will be accessible to watch on Netflix in all areas simultaneously, however the specific time will shift contingent upon your area.

Netflix discharges its unique substance at 12 PM Pacific Time, and that implies that you should change your clock as per your time region. Netflix's delivery plan for One Piece: What time does it debut?

One Piece surprisingly realistic will be accessible on Netflix on Thursday, August 31st.


The series will be delivered on Netflix simultaneously for all districts, however the time will vary contingent upon your time region.

Here is a rundown of a portion of the delivery times for various time regions, nations, and urban communities:


US (PT) - 12:00 AM
US (ET) - 03:00 AM
Canada - 3:00 AM (Toronto), 12:00 AM (Vancouver)
Brazil (Rio De Janiero) - 4:00 AM
Joined Realm (BST) - 8:00 AM
Europe (Focal European Time) - 9:00 AM
Europe (Eastern European Time) - 10:00 AM
South Africa (Cape Town, Focal Africa Time) - 9:00 AM
India (New Delhi) - 12:30 PM
Indonesia (Jakarta) - 2:00 PM
Philippines (Manila) - 3:00 PM
Hong Kong - 3:00 PM
Singapore - 3:00 PM
Australia - 3:00 PM (Perth), 5:00 PM (Sydney)
Japan (Tokyo) - 4:00 PM
New Zealand (Auckland) - 7:00 PM

A sum of eight episodes from One Piece will be prepared for spilling on August 31st, without a moment's delay.

Alien: Covenant "Alien: Covenant" is a science fiction horror film released in 2017. It is the second installment in the "Alien" prequel series and serves as a sequel to "Prometheus" (2012). The film was directed by Ridley Scott and written by John Logan and Dante Harper. The story is set in the same universe as the original "Alien" film series and follows the crew of the colony ship Covenant as they travel to a remote planet in hopes of establishing a new human colony. However, they stumble upon a seemingly uncharted paradise that soon reveals itself to be a dangerous and horrifying world inhabited by deadly creatures. The film explores themes of creation, artificial intelligence, and the origins of the Xenomorph species. The cast includes actors such as Michael Fassbender, Katherine Waterston, Billy Crudup, Danny McBride, and others.
